The 27-year-old native of Montreal pleaded guilty to multiple charges in a Montreal court in late June: computer enticement, inciting sexual contact with a minor under the age of 16, production and access to child pornography.
“A relapse”. This is how Tommy-Lee Goneau explained to investigators what he did after his arrest in the summer of 2022. When he attacked this teenager, the cyber robber was under a three-year suspended sentence that prohibited him from having contact with minors. In July 2019, he was sentenced to one year in prison for triple fraud at the Saint-Jérôme courthouse.
In April 2022, Tommy-Lee Goneau met the then 10-year-old victim at the game Fortnite, which was extremely popular with young people. They start chatting on the social network Snapchat. The victim initially states that the 25-year-old is 16, soon 17. Later she will tell him that she is 15 years old. It is therefore not proven that the defendant knew the true age of his victim.
Though their exchange was only virtual, the two considered each other to be in a “relationship.” “The two fell in love,” summed up Crown Prosecutor Me Hugo Rousse. But Tommy-Lee Goneau didn’t want their “relationship” to be known.

If the cyber robber produced child pornography, it was during a “sexting” session with the victim, i.e. during written conversations.
“Through words he will position children. He will ask [à la victime] what to do and tell her what he wants from her. I think it will be relevant to the sentence that I give you examples. [Ça montre] All the intimacy that existed between the two,” explained Me Rousse judge Pierre E. Labelle.
Tommy-Lee Goneau also blackmailed the victim. According to the prosecutor, it was more like “emotional blackmail” than the type of blackmail a cyber robber typically carries out, threatening to post photos of the victim online if they are not given others.
In late August, after months of discussions, the victim’s mother finally discovered the pot of roses when she got her hands on her daughter’s cell phone. After his arrest, Tommy-Lee Goneau told investigators that he “needed help” even though he was already in therapy.

The Crown prosecutor told the court it was “seriously considering” asking the judge to have Tommy-Lee Goneau evaluated to determine if he should be classified as a long-term offender. If given this label, the young man could be subject to strict long-term surveillance after his release from prison.
The case will be heard again in court next September. Me Ann Wasaja is representing the accused.
